If your Limited Liability Company (LLC) was originally formed in a state other than Illinois but you now plan to conduct business within the Prairie State, you'll need to register as a foreign LLC. This process, often called "qualifying" your business, allows your company to legally operate and be recognized by Illinois authorities. Failing to register can lead to penalties, fines, and an inability to enforce contracts in Illinois courts. Registering a foreign LLC in Illinois involves submitting specific documentation to the Illinois Secretary of State, appointing a registered agent located within Illinois, and paying the necessary filing fees. This is distinct from forming a new LLC entirely; you are essentially informing Illinois that your existing, legally formed entity will now be conducting business within their jurisdiction.
